I wish to let my maid transfer, what are my responsibilities?

Written consent must be given. You must continue to pay the maid levy up to the day before the new Work Permit is issued. If the maid's medical was done five months ago, as her employer still, you are responsible to send the maid for her 6-Monthly Medical Examination if required.

In the event that the maid's transfer is unsuccessful and the Work Permit is cancelled or expires, you as the current employer must repatriate the maid within 14 days from the date of the Work Permit cancellation/expiry.

The maid is only allowed to start work with the new employer after the Work Permit has been issued in the new employer's name and any outstanding salary should be paid on the day you release her.

For the purpose of transfer, you will not need to pay anything to the maid agency unless you require the agency to provide food and accommodation for the interim. However, do note that the salary of the maid is to be paid even though she may no longer be performing any work for you while staying with the agency.

How much is the maid's levy?

The maid's levy is either $300 (normal) or $60 (concession) and to be paid by the employer at the end of each month via GIRO. The maid Work Permit will be cancelled if you fail to maintain a valid GIRO account.

The levy for each month is payable by the employer at the end of each month. The payment due date is the 14th (for manual payment) or 17th (for GIRO payment) of the following month. If the 17th is a non-working day, the deduction will be made on the next working day.

Levy Concession

You can apply for a levy concession for up to two Maids if you satisfy any of the following conditions:

Condition A
i.The employer or spouse has a child who is a Singapore citizen and below 16 years old living with him/her
ii.The employer or spouse has a grandchild who is a Singapore citizen and below 16 years old living with him/her.

Condition B
i.The employer or co-residing spouse is a Singapore Citizen aged 65 years or above
ii.The employer or spouse is a Singapore Citizen and the other party is a Singapore Permanent Resident aged 65 years or above, both of whom live at the same registered address as in the NRIC.

Condition C
i.The employer or spouse has a parent, parent-in-law, grandparent or grandparent-in-law who is a Singapore Citizen aged 65 years or above, living with them at the same registered address as in the NRIC
ii.The employer or spouse is a Singapore Citizen and has a parent, parent-in-law, grandparent or grandparent-in-law who is a Singapore Permanent Resident aged 65 years or above, living with them at the same registered address as in the NRIC.

Condition D
Employers with disabilities or who have family members with disabilities and require a full-time caregiver assistance in daily activities (washing/bathing, feeding, going to the toilet, dressing and mobility).

How long will it take for the Work Permit application to be approved by MOM?

Step 1: Submission of Application
We can only proceed with this step once all required documents has been handed over to us.

Step 2: Assessment and Approval
It takes up to seven days to process a Work Permit application with the Ministry of Manpower (MOM) for your maid on your behalf.

Note: If your maid's Work Permit application is rejected by MOM, we will then proceed with Step 3.

Step 3: Appeal
It takes up to 14 days for the Appeal to be accepted and Work Permit application to be approved by MOM.

Who can hire a maid in Singapore?

As long as you are a working adult who is a Singapore Citizen or a Singapore PR or a foreigner with valid employment pass, you may hire a maid.

If you do not have any income, you will be required to show proof of a minimum sum of SG$50,000 fixed deposit before submitting the work permit application for the maid.

What is the minimum wage for a maid in Singapore?

Ministry of Manpower (MOM) does not stipulate a minimum wage and would prefer market force to determine the salary.

How to hire an additional maid?

If your family nucleus consists of 2 children under 18 or 1 child under 18 and 1 elderly above 65, you should be able to qualify for an additional maid. Your combined annual income should at least be SG$50,000 and above.

Am I responsible to buy an air ticket and repatriate my maid when she is the one whom initiated to break the contract prematurely?

The hard truth is yes. As her employer, even if your maid has only worked for you for a day, the fact is you are her employer and the Ministry of Manpower takes this very seriously should any complaint be made against you for forcing your maid the pay for her air ticket back to her country of origin.

A good alternative to sending her home should your maid still wish to work in Singapore, is to simply allow her to transfer. This way, you get to save back the cost of the 1-way air ticket and save yourself the trouble to send her to the airport for her flight.

And if you have hired her from a maid agency, simply approach them to see if they are willing to assist with her transfer to another employer. Otherwise, simply approach another maid agency like us and we will advise you accordingly if we can help her transfer or not.

I am a first-time employer and ready to hire my first maid, what should I do?

The first thing to do is to give us a call @ 6735 3456 and provide us with your detailed requirements. Same time, you should complete your Employer's Orientation Programme (EOP) which is a mandatory training programme for all first-time employers who wish to employ a foreign domestic worker (FDW).

To sign up, you should have your SingPass ready and the fee for Online E-Learning is S$46, payable with your Visa/Master cards or Internet Banking. It will take you no more than 2 hours usually to complete the course online and once that is done, please print out a copy of your EOP Certificate and give it to us.

Can my FDW follow my kids to my Mother-In-Law house and do the housework there while my MIL takes care of my kid?

You will need to make a formal declaration to the Ministry of Manpower that your Foreign Domestic Worker (FDW) will have to perform her care duties for your kids at your MIL house and she must not do any housework or cooking in your MIL house unless the cooking is for your kids. Do take note that your FDW should always reside and perform housework only at your residence.

This is also provided your kids are at your MIL house.

It cannot be a situation whereby you simply instruct your FDW to go do some minimal housework at your MIL house and your kids are not there.

MOM takes a serious view on this matter and you should not breach this at all times.
